The next generation of blockchain solutions is addressing previous limitations, making them more practical for large-scale supply chain deployments. Improvements in scalability, through techniques like sharding and layer-2 solutions, are crucial for handling the massive volume of data involved in global supply chains. Increased interoperability, allowing different blockchain networks to communicate seamlessly, will facilitate greater collaboration and data sharing between businesses, even those using different blockchain platforms.
This improved infrastructure lays the foundation for wider adoption and integration.
Enhanced Sustainability and Ethical Practices through Blockchain
Blockchain’s inherent transparency and immutability are powerful tools for promoting sustainability and ethical practices within supply chains. By tracking the origin and journey of goods, blockchain can verify certifications, such as fair trade or organic labeling, reducing the risk of fraud and greenwashing. For example, a coffee producer can use blockchain to record the entire process, from bean cultivation to packaging, ensuring traceability and verifying its adherence to sustainable farming practices.
Consumers can then access this information through a QR code, building trust and fostering greater consumer responsibility. Similarly, the provenance of materials used in manufacturing can be verified, helping companies meet increasingly stringent environmental and social responsibility standards. This transparency empowers both businesses and consumers to make more informed and ethical purchasing decisions.
Predictive Adoption of Blockchain Across Supply Chain Sectors
While blockchain adoption is still in its relatively early stages, specific sectors are poised for significant growth in the coming years. The food and beverage industry, with its complex and often opaque supply chains, is an ideal candidate for blockchain implementation. Tracking food products from farm to table not only improves traceability but also enables faster response times during product recalls, minimizing risks and improving public health.
The pharmaceutical industry, with its high demand for security and authenticity, is also experiencing increasing blockchain adoption to combat counterfeiting and ensure drug integrity. The luxury goods sector, aiming to combat counterfeits and enhance brand authenticity, is another sector that is showing significant interest in blockchain technology for verifying the authenticity and provenance of high-value products. While widespread adoption across all sectors may take time, these specific industries represent strong early indicators of future growth and integration.

What are the challenges in implementing blockchain in a supply chain?
Challenges include the cost of implementation, integration with existing systems, scalability issues, and the need for industry-wide adoption and standardization.
